Abstract

Embodiments of the present disclosure provide method and apparatus for session restoration. A method performed by a network node includes receiving a first request for setting up a session with required quality of service (QOS) from an application node. The method further includes sending a first response including error information and subscription information of an existing session including a subscription identifier to the application node.

Claims (66)

1 . A method performed by a network exposure node, comprising:

receiving from an application node a second request for retrieving subscription data for the application node, wherein the second request comprises identification information of one or more user equipments (UEs); and

sending a second response comprising one or more subscription data created by the application node corresponding to the identification information of one or more UEs to the application node.

2 . The method according to claim 1 , wherein identification information of a UE comprises at least one of:

an Internet protocol version 4 address of the UE,

an Internet protocol domain,

an identifier of the UE,

a MAC address of the UE, or

an Internet protocol version 6 address of the UE.

3 . The method according to claim 1 , wherein the second response further comprises at least one of:

at least one QoS flow status corresponding to the subscription data, or

at least one notification event corresponding to the subscription data.

4 . The method according to claim 1 , wherein the second request is an HTTP GET request and the second response is an HTTP GET response.

5 . The method according to claim 1 , wherein the network exposure node comprises at least one of:

an exposure function node, or

a policy control node.

6 . The method according to claim 5 , wherein the policy control node comprises at least one of:

Policy Control Function (PCF), or

Policy and Charging Rules Function (PCRF).

7 . The method according to claim 5 , wherein the exposure function node comprises at least one of:

Service Capability Exposure Function (SCEF),

Network Exposure Function (NEF), or

SCEF combined with NEF.

8 . The method according to claim 1 , wherein the application node comprises at least one of:

application function,

application server (AS), or

services capability server (SCS).

9 . The method according to claim 1 , wherein the second request is triggered for recovery; and/or wherein the second response comprises queried active subscriptions for the application node.
